84 个版本
0.2.61 | 2024年1月2日 |
---|---|
0.2.60 | 2023年10月17日 |
0.2.54 | 2023年9月18日 |
0.2.52 | 2023年6月16日 |
0.0.0 | 2020年5月15日 |
440 在 命令行工具 中排名
每月 326 次下载
465KB
13K SLoC
Hop CLI
Hop CLI 允许您通过命令行与 Hop 服务交互。它可以替代 控制台 使用。
安装
以下任何一种方法都可以使
hop
命令对您可用。
Arch Linux
使用您喜欢的 AUR 辅助工具安装软件包(例如 paru)
paru -S hop-cli
Windows
使用 Hop Windows 安装程序 64位 或 Hop Windows 安装程序 32位 安装
Homebrew
brew install hopinc/tap/hop
Linux、MacOS 和 FreeBSD
可以使用我们的通用安装脚本进行安装
curl -fsSL https://download.hop.sh/install | sh
源代码
要从源代码构建应用程序,您首先需要安装 Rust。然后,在克隆了存储库之后,您可以在目录中执行此命令
cargo install --path .
登录
要开始,您需要通过 CLI 登录到您的 Hop 账户
hop auth login
浏览器窗口将打开 Hop 控制台,并提示您允许 CLI 连接到您的账户。完成操作后,您将被重定向回来。
就是这样!您现在可以开始使用 CLI 了。
用法
项目
您可以设置一个默认项目以使用,这将自动应用于每个命令。
hop projects switch
您可以通过传递 --project
参数来覆盖它。例如,hop deploy --project api
。
部署
要部署项目目录,首先通过 cd
导航到目录,然后执行
hop deploy
这将把项目部署到 Hop,或者如果您还没有 Hopfile(《hop.yml》)则创建一个。
链接
要将项目链接到服务,首先通过 cd
导航到目录,然后执行
hop link
此操作将目录链接到部署并创建一个Hopfile(《hop.yml
》)。
贡献
欢迎贡献!如果您发现任何错误或有任何建议,请打开一个问题或拉取请求。
依赖项
~19–37MB
~631K SLoC